- INTERMITTENT CONDITION
- Turn the ignition on.
- With the scan tool, clear all DTCs.
- Turn the High Beam Headlamps on.
- With the scan tool, read DTCs.
Does the scan tool display DTC: B1638-RIGHT HI BEAM CONTROL CIRCUIT HIGH?
Yes
- Go To 2
No
- Test complete, the condition or conditions that originally set this DTC are not present at this time. Using the wiring diagrams as a guide, check all related splices and connectors for signs of water intrusion, corrosion, pushed out or bent terminals, and correct pin tension.
- Perform the BODY VERIFICATION TEST. Refer to STANDARD PROCEDURE .
- CHECK THE (L34) RIGHT HIGH BEAM DRIVER CIRCUIT FOR A SHORT TO VOLTAGE IN THE HARNESS

- Turn the Headlamps off.
- Turn the ignition off.
- Disconnect the Right Headlamp Lamp harness connector.
- Disconnect the TIPM C3 harness connector.
- Turn the ignition on.
- Measure the voltage between ground and the (L34) Right High Beam Driver circuit.
Is there any voltage present?
Yes
- Repair the short to voltage in the (L34) Right High Beam Driver circuit.
- Perform the BODY VERIFICATION TEST. Refer to STANDARD PROCEDURE .
No
- Go To 3
- CHECK THE TIPM FOR CORRECT OPERATION
- Turn the ignition off.
- Reconnect the TIPM C3 harness connector.
- Connect a 12-volt test light between the (L34) Right High Beam Driver circuit and (L910) Right Headlamp Return Signal circuit in the Right Headlamp Lamp harness connector.
- Turn the ignition on.
- Turn the High Beam Headlamps on.
Does the test light illuminate brightly?
Yes
- Replace the Right High Beam Bulb in accordance with the Service Information.
- Perform the BODY VERIFICATION TEST. Refer to STANDARD PROCEDURE .
No
- Go To 4
- CHECK THE (L34) RIGHT HIGH BEAM DRIVER CIRCUIT FOR AN OPEN IN THE HARNESS
- Turn the ignition off.
- Disconnect the TIPM C3 harness connector.
- Measure the resistance of the (L34) Right High Beam Driver circuit between the Right Headlamp Lamp harness connector and the TIPM C3 harness connector.
Is the resistance below 5.0 Ohms?
Yes
- Go To 5
No
- Repair the open in the (L34) Right High Beam Driver circuit.
- Perform the BODY VERIFICATION TEST. Refer to STANDARD PROCEDURE .
- CHECK THE (L910) RIGHT HEADLAMP RETURN SIGNAL CIRCUIT FOR AN OPEN IN THE HARNESS
- Measure the resistance of the (L910) Right Headlamp Return Signal circuit between the Right Headlamp Lamp harness connector and the TIPM C3 harness connector.
Is the resistance below 5.0 Ohms?
Yes
- Replace the Totally Integrated Power Module (TIPM) in accordance with the Service Information.
- Perform the BODY VERIFICATION TEST. Refer to STANDARD PROCEDURE .
No
- Repair the open in the (L910) Right Headlamp Return Signal circuit.
- Perform the BODY VERIFICATION TEST. Refer to STANDARD PROCEDURE .
